Westminster School barely beat Trinity-Pawling School the last time the pair played, but that sure wasn't the case this time around. The Martlets put the hurt on the Pride with a sharp 11-1 win on Saturday. The Martlets haven't had any issues with the Pride recently, as the game was their third consecutive victory against them.
Alex Mihailovich was incredible, going 2-for-4 with four RBI, one stolen base, and one double. Those four RBI gave him a new career-high. Easton Masse was another key player, going a perfect 2-for-2 with one stolen base, one run, and one RBI.
Westminster School always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.594.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Trinity-Pawling School only posted an OBP of .263.
The win got Westminster School back to even at 6-6. As for Trinity-Pawling School, they have been struggling recently as they've lost three of their last four matches. That's put a noticeable dent in their 4-6 record this season.
